Introduction

S&P 500 futures are financial contracts that allow investors to speculate on the future value of the S&P 500 index, which is composed of 500 of the largest publicly traded companies in the United States. As an important barometer of the stock market’s performance, these futures play a crucial role in helping investors manage risk and set their investment strategies. Key Factors Influencing S&P 500 Futures

Several key factors influence S&P 500 futures, including:

  • Economic Indicators: Reports on employment numbers, consumer spending, and GDP growth significantly affect market sentiment.
  • Federal Reserve Policies: Speculation surrounding interest rate adjustments impacts investor confidence, with futures often moving in anticipation of such decisions.
  • Geopolitical Events: International tensions and trade agreements can create uncertainty, leading to fluctuations in futures prices.
  • Technological Sector Performance: Given the outsized influence of technology stocks in the S&P 500, trends in this sector are particularly vital for future forecasts.
